Garlic Herb Roasted Beef and Vegetables

Tender sirloin strips roasted with vibrant bell peppers and broccoli, infused with a fragrant garlic-herb oil that creates a savory, golden finish.

NUTRITION

499kcal
Protein
56.1g
Fat
19.9g
Carbs
27.0g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

6 oz Lean Sirloin Steak

1 cup Broccoli florets

1 cup Red bell pepper

0.5 cup Carrots

0.5 tbsp Extra virgin olive oil

2 cloves Garlic

0.5 tsp Dried oregano

0.5 tsp Dried thyme

0.25 tsp Sea salt

0.25 tsp Black pepper

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a large rimmed baking sheet with parchment paper for easy cleanup.

  • 2

    Slice the lean sirloin steak into 1-inch cubes and place them in a large mixing bowl.

  • 3

    Cut the broccoli into bite-sized florets, slice the bell peppers into thin strips, and coin the carrots into rounds.

  • 4

    Finely mince the garlic cloves and add them to the bowl with the steak and vegetables.

  • 5

    Drizzle the extra virgin olive oil over the ingredients, then sprinkle with dried oregano, dried thyme, sea salt, and black pepper.

  • 6

    Toss everything thoroughly until the beef and vegetables are evenly coated in the oil and aromatic seasonings.

  • 7

    Spread the mixture in a single layer on the prepared baking sheet, ensuring there is enough space between pieces for even roasting.

  • 8

    Roast in the center of the oven for 15-18 minutes, or until the steak reaches your desired level of doneness and the vegetables are tender-crisp.

  • 9

    Remove from the oven and let the beef rest for 2 minutes before serving to allow the juices to redistribute.
